What is UACR (Urine Albumin-to-Creatinine Ratio)?
UACR is a laboratory test that measures the amount of albumin (a protein) relative to creatinine in a spot urine sample, serving as the gold standard screening and monitoring tool for kidney damage because it accurately detects albuminuria without requiring cumbersome 24-hour urine collections. 1, 2
Definition and Measurement
- UACR normalizes albumin excretion for variations in urine concentration by dividing urinary albumin (mg) by urinary creatinine (g), expressed as mg/g 1, 2
- The test eliminates the need for inconvenient and error-prone timed urine collections while providing an accurate estimate of albumin excretion rate 2
- A first morning void sample yields the lowest coefficient of variation (31%) and is the preferred collection method 2, 3
Clinical Categories and Risk Stratification
The American Diabetes Association and KDIGO guidelines classify UACR into three categories that directly correlate with cardiovascular and kidney disease risk: 1, 3
A1 (Normal to Mildly Increased): UACR <30 mg/g (<3 mg/mmol)
A2 (Moderately Increased Albuminuria): UACR 30-299 mg/g (3-29 mg/mmol)
A3 (Severely Increased Albuminuria): UACR ≥300 mg/g (≥30 mg/mmol)
At any level of kidney function, increased UACR independently raises the risk for adverse cardiovascular outcomes, chronic kidney disease progression, and all-cause mortality 2, 4
The risk increases continuously as UACR rises, even within the normal and moderately increased ranges 2, 4
Why Creatinine is Used in the Ratio
- Creatinine serves as a marker of urine concentration, allowing accurate normalization of albumin levels regardless of hydration status 2
- The ratio correlates strongly with 24-hour albumin excretion (Pearson's r = 0.87-0.88) while being far more convenient 5, 6
- Measuring albumin alone without creatinine is susceptible to false-negative and false-positive results due to variations in urine dilution 2
Screening Recommendations
For Type 1 Diabetes: Begin screening 5 years after diagnosis with annual monitoring thereafter 1, 2
For Type 2 Diabetes: Begin screening at diagnosis due to uncertain disease onset, with annual monitoring 1, 2
- First morning void samples should be collected at the same time of day, with no food ingestion for at least 2 hours prior 2, 3
Factors That Can Falsely Elevate UACR
The following conditions must be excluded before confirming chronic albuminuria: 2, 3
- Exercise within 24 hours
- Active urinary tract infection or fever
- Congestive heart failure exacerbation
- Marked hyperglycemia
- Menstruation
- Marked uncontrolled hypertension
Confirmation of Abnormal Results
- Due to high day-to-day variability (coefficient of variation 48.8%), elevated UACR requires confirmation with 2 out of 3 positive samples collected over 3-6 months before diagnosing persistent albuminuria 2, 7
- A single UACR increase from 2 to 5 mg/mmol has only a 50% probability of representing a true 30% increase, rising to 97% when 2 collections are obtained at each time point 7
Clinical Significance
- UACR is a continuous measurement where differences within both normal and abnormal ranges are associated with renal and cardiovascular outcomes 2, 4
- Even high-normal UACR values (>10 mg/g in men, >8 mg/g in women) predict increased risk of chronic kidney disease progression in patients with type 2 diabetes 8
- The presence of albuminuria markedly increases cardiovascular risk and healthcare costs in patients with diabetes 4
